The University of Sheffield confers honorary degrees (or degrees honoris causa – as a ‘mark of honour’) on people who have given distinguished service or brought distinction to the University, the City of Sheffield or the region. Alumni who received honorary degrees from the University in 2018:
Dorothy Byrne (PG Dip Business Studies 1974, Hon LittD 2018): Head of News and Current Affairs at Channel 4.
Dr Francis Froes (MMet Physical Metallurgy 1963, PhD Physical Metallurgy 1967, Hon DEng 2018): scholar in the field of titanium science and technology.
Brian Gilvary (BSc Mathematics 1983, Hon DSc 2018): Chief Financial Officer and Director of BP.
Agnes Grunwald-Spier MBE (MA Holocaust Studies 1998, Hon LittD 2018): author and historian committed to raising Holocaust awareness.
Andy Haldane (BA Accounting, Financial Management and Economics 1988, Hon LittD 2018): Chief Economist and Executive Director of Monetary Analysis, Research and Statistics at the Bank of England.
Dr Bernard Johnston (BEng Civil and Structural Engineering 1965, PhD Civil and Structural Engineering 1974, Hon DEng 2018): educator and industrial engineer.
Dr Lowell Lewis (MBChB Medicine 1976, Hon MD 2018): Chief Medical Officer of Montserrat.
Lucy Nickson (PG Dip Management and Leadership 2011, Hon MD 2018): management expert within the health and charity sectors in the region.
Ann Sansom (BA English Literature 1994, Hon LittD 2018) and Peter Sansom (Hon LittD 2018): distinguished poets and Directors of The Poetry Business, the Sheffield-based poetry publisher and writer development agency.
